AMES Taping Tools

AMES Taping Tools is the leading provider of automatic taping and finishing (ATF) tools, supplies and training to the professional drywall finishing industry. AMES'​ principal business is the rental and service of ATF tools through its network of more than 114 Company stores and franchised locations throughout the United States and Canada. AMES supplies, supports and services residential and commercial interior finishing contractors with the industry’s largest retail operation. Contractor services include professional education and certification programs, which are available via in-store demonstrations, classroom training, and job site instruction. In 1939, AMES invented ATF tool technology and continued to refine the process with the introduction of the BAZOOKA in the 1950s. This finishing system dramatically improves the speed, quality and efficiency of the professional drywall contractor. Company stores offer a variety of merchandise including branded and private label hand-finishing drywall tools, supplies and accessories, making AMES a "one-stop shop"​ for interior finishing contractors. In addition to its finishing tool rental business, AMES also sells ATF tools under the TapeTech® brand, through over 300 independent distributors and dealers. AMES is headquartered in Suwanee, Georgia.
